French term or phrase: denture d’entraînement
Hi,

A ce sujet, on notera que les versions à bague interne en deux parties (figures 6-10) ou à bague externe en deux parties (figures 3, 4, 11) seront utiles pour le positionnement de la denture d’entraînement 33 qui se fera toujours sur la bague en une partie. Suivant les configurations, la denture est sur la bague radialement intérieure ou la bague extérieure.

drive ..?
thanks
loulou79
(pinion) drive teeth
Explanation:
This appears to be describing a gear on which the teeth may be machined either on the inner or on the outer radius. Both are possible of course, but for the former, both wheels rotate in the same direction (but at different speeds), whereas the opposite is true for the latter.
